About This Waterfall

Big Creek is a small tributary to the Sandy River just outside south of the town of Corbett. The stream produces a waterfall about 70 feet in height about one-third of a mile from where it flows into the Sandy River. Due to the topography of the canyon where the falls are found, the only feasible access to the falls will be by shuttling across the Sandy River in a raft or canoe, and then bushwhacking upstream to the falls (private property lines the rim of the canyon, preventing views from above).
